С ошибкой этой библиотеки сталкиваются геймеры. В частности, те, кто использует приложение Steam от компании Valve. Чаще всего ошибка возникает в двух сценариях.
Оба сценария довольно распространены и касаются множества популярных игр. Под раздачу попали такие хиты как Far Cry и Assassin’s Creed. Более того, даже не имеющий никакого отношения к Steam World of Warcraft пострадал. К счастью, есть ряд процедур, которые «лечат» эти симптомы несмотря на то, что точная причина возникновения ошибки толком неизвестна.
Эта одна из базовых вещей, которые нужно сделать, когда ошибкой отзывается DLL-файл от сторонней компании. Иногда случается так, что чужеродный файл воспринимается как угроза без всякого основания. То есть абсолютно безопасная библиотека вдруг попадает в карантин. Оттуда, конечно, Windows ее «прочитать» не может.
В качестве решения могу посоветовать временно выключить антивирус и проверить, как игры и Steam отреагируют на это действие. Мы уже писали о том, как выключить встроенные средства защиты Windows 10 и как выключить популярный антивирус Avast .
Если ошибка появляется только при запуске игр компании Ubisoft, то причина может крыться в устаревшей версии клиента uPlay. Надо просто его обновить. Для этого:
А дальше нужно следовать простым инструкциям установщика. Там все без изысков. Просто нажимаем «Далее» пока приложение не установится.
Когда проблема не уходит даже после выполнения вышеописанных действий, приходится заменять нерабочую библиотеку вручную. Действуем по следующему алгоритму:
Внизу есть каталог всех DLL-файлов, но в нем искать сложнее
Вот ссылка. Под строкой «Имя файла»
Скачиваем подходящий вариант
После этого на жестком диске появится архив с заменой нерабочей библиотеки. В архиве она остается для нас бесполезной, поэтому достаем ее оттуда и кладем в нужную папку.
Как видите, это сжатая папка
По пути надо указать путь распаковки, но его можно не менять
Можно просто нажать Ctrl + C
Иногда mercurial, при скачивании и комитах ругается на https. Особенно на самоподписанные сертификаты. Чтобы заработал…
Если возникает ошибка libvirt destroy lxc permission denied , при попытке остановить контейнер: _x000D_# virsh…
Иногда возникает ситуация, когда криво настроенные пакеты не устанавливаются в системе. У меня это произошло…